Limited edition pet subscription boxes offer exclusive, one-time collections tailored for special occasions or seasonal themes, providing unique treats and toys that aren't available in regular offerings. Ongoing subscriptions deliver a steady supply of curated products suited to your pet's needs and preferences, ensuring variety and consistent enjoyment. Choosing between the two depends on whether you seek rare, collectible items or a reliable source of new pet surprises every month.
Table of Comparison
Feature | Limited Edition Box | Ongoing Subscription |
---|---|---|
Availability | One-time purchase, exclusive | Recurring monthly delivery |
Content | Unique, themed items not repeated | Varied selections, refreshed regularly |
Price | Higher price, one-time fee | Lower monthly cost, ongoing billing |
Commitment | No subscription, pay once | Requires active subscription, cancel anytime |
Ideal for | Collectors and gift buyers | Regular users seeking variety |
Special perks | Exclusive items, limited availability | Discounts, early access to products |

Pricing Comparison: One-Time vs Recurring Costs
Limited edition boxes often come with a higher upfront cost compared to ongoing subscription services, which spread the expense over multiple payments, resulting in lower monthly fees. Recurring subscriptions provide consistent value and often include discounts or exclusive perks, balancing cost over time versus the single, premium payment of a limited edition box. Consumers must weigh the affordability and commitment level of ongoing subscriptions against the unique appeal and one-time payment of limited edition offerings.

FOMO (Fear of Missing Out) and Marketing Strategies
Limited edition subscription boxes leverage FOMO by offering exclusive, time-sensitive products that create urgency and drive impulse purchases. Ongoing subscriptions rely on consistent value and brand loyalty, often incorporating early access or subscriber-only perks to maintain engagement. Marketing strategies for limited editions emphasize scarcity and exclusivity, while ongoing subscriptions focus on building long-term customer relationships through personalized experiences and regular content updates.
